EDITING KEYS ON THE TRACK BAR

If you wanted to change the keys to adjust the timing you would do so by left clicking and dragging over them and then the left mouse button will allow you to move the selected keys.
You may pull that selected key wherever you wish from that point forward.  The further away you move the frames the slower the animation will be versus the closer they are the faster they will be. You can also highlight the keys similarly and then press delete to remove the keys.
Right click on the drop bar and you will be able to find your selection range.
And now you may alter the key frames en mass. And you may scale the keys by grabbing either handle on either side. Go to the left with this you may speed up that section of the animation and when you go right you may slow it down.
You may right click on a key and access the information of it, and if you go to the delete key you have access to the keys on that specific frame.
Now you may use the same technique above and see the specific information of a key. And you then have the ability to change the value and tension types.
